ORDER
Vinay Kumar, Member - Complainant Pooja Gupta, Respondent in the present Revision Petition was enrolled for one year management course in France. For this she was reportedly required to have health insurance cover as a mandatory visa condition. This insurance cover was taken from M/s. Tata AIG Insurance Company, the Revision Petitioner in the present proceedings. The policy cover was for a period of 90 days from 27.7.2004 to 24.10.2004. The policy was taken through the Chandigarh branch of M/s. Tata AIG, impleaded as OP-2 in the proceedings before the District Forum.
2. Upon expiry of the above policy, further insurance cover was taken for 270 days duration from 6.11.2004 to 2.8.2005. It is referred to as "renewal" of the existing policy by the Complainant/Respondent and "new policy" by the Revision Petitioner/OP-1.
3. The case of the complainant is that during the middle of the tenure of this Insurance Policy, the Complainant fell seriously ill in Paris and was shifted to the nearest hospital called "Embroise Pare".
